How to Leverage Your Experience as an Auto Parts Brand Owner and Software Developer to Identify and Validate Innovative Business Opportunities in Automotive Tech

The automotive technology sector is rapidly evolving, driven by electrification, connectivity, autonomous driving, and smart mobility. As both an auto parts brand owner and a software developer, you possess a unique blend of industry insight and technical prowess that can help you identify and validate cutting-edge business opportunities. This guide will help you strategically utilize your dual expertise to create impactful, innovative solutions in automotive tech.


1. Leverage Domain Expertise to Pinpoint Industry Pain Points

Your intimate knowledge of the auto parts ecosystem—covering supply chains, manufacturers, distributors, mechanics, and end users—provides a competitive advantage in identifying unaddressed challenges:

  • Compatibility & Fitment: Resolving confusion over exact parts fitting specific vehicle models through data-driven tools.
  • Inventory Complexities: Enhancing real-time parts tracking and multi-supplier inventory management.
  • Quality Assurance: Ensuring aftermarket parts meet or exceed OEM standards.
  • Installation & Service: Offering digital guidance or diagnostic tools to assist customers and repair shops.

Translate Pain Points into Tech Innovation

Use your software skills to conceptualize solutions such as:

  • AI-powered parts recommendation engines that cross-reference vehicle data.
  • Blockchain-based platforms for transparent, tamper-proof supply chains.
  • Augmented Reality (AR) apps for step-by-step installation instructions.
  • Predictive analytics forecasting inventory needs and part failures.

2. Rapid Prototype Development Using Software Skills

Turn your ideas into Minimum Viable Products (MVPs) or proofs-of-concept quickly to test assumptions with low initial investment.

Why Rapid Prototyping Matters

  • Validates concepts with real users early.
  • Facilitates agile iterations based on user feedback.
  • Reduces development costs and market risks.

Automotive Tech Prototyping Examples

  • VIN-based mobile apps recommending part compatibility.
  • Machine learning models predicting part failure or maintenance needs.
  • Web dashboards for aftermarket store inventory tracking in real-time.

Recommended Development Tools & Frameworks

  • React Native or Flutter for cross-platform mobile app development.
  • Python frameworks such as Flask or FastAPI for backend APIs.
  • AI frameworks like TensorFlow or PyTorch for predictive models.
  • GitHub for version control and collaborative coding.

Use cloud services like AWS, Google Cloud, or Azure for scalable deployment and data processing.

4. Exploit Your Brand’s Data & Analytics for Market Insights

Your auto parts business generates valuable data assets that you can analyze to uncover trends and unmet needs.

Key Data Sources to Mine

  • Sales and transaction volumes.
  • Customer service inquiries and complaint logs.
  • Returns and warranty claim patterns.
  • Website traffic analytics.
  • Social media sentiment and engagement metrics.

Analytical Strategies

  • Trend Analysis: Track emerging parts demand (e.g., EV battery components).
  • Segmentation: Identify lucrative customer groups or underserved demographics.
  • Predictive Modeling: Forecast demand fluctuations or part failure risks.
  • Sentiment Analysis: Use natural language processing (NLP) to assess customer feedback tone.

Analytical Tools

  • Python libraries like Pandas, NumPy, and scikit-learn.
  • Visualization tools including Tableau, Power BI, or Plotly.
  • Cloud AI and machine learning platforms (AWS SageMaker, Google AI).

5. Align Innovation with Cutting-Edge Automotive Tech Trends

Your hybrid expertise positions you to capitalize on key industry trends:

Electrification & Electric Vehicles (EVs)

  • Develop battery health monitoring and predictive maintenance apps.
  • Understand EV-specific part constraints and regulatory requirements for better product design.

Connected Vehicles & Telematics

  • Integrate IoT sensors with auto parts to gather real-time performance data.
  • Build platforms offering predictive analytics and automated reordering.

Autonomous Driving & ADAS

  • Create diagnostic and calibration software for radar, lidar, and camera parts.
  • Offer middleware solutions facilitating integration between hardware components and vehicle systems.

Mobility-as-a-Service (MaaS)

  • Enable fleet management using software platforms for predictive maintenance and asset tracking.
  • Develop subscription or usage-based models aligned with fleet operators.

6. Bridge Hardware and Software for Differentiated Solutions

Your combined skills enable innovation at the intersection of physical parts and digital systems:

  • Embed sensors into auto parts for real-time data streaming to cloud-based analytics platforms.
  • Use AR-enabled repair tools linked to your parts inventory for improved customer support.
  • Develop lifecycle management software optimizing part usage based on collected telemetry.

This hardware-software fusion can create strong competitive moats difficult for pure software or pure parts companies to replicate.

8. Explore Synergistic Business Models Tailored to Automotive Tech

Integrate your dual expertise into diverse, scalable revenue models:

  • Subscription SaaS for inventory management, fleet maintenance, or parts tracking.
  • Marketplace Platforms connecting suppliers, mechanics, and consumers with intelligent matching and logistics.
  • Predictive Maintenance as a Service offering data-driven insights to fleets or repair shops.
  • Hybrid Models bundling premium auto parts sales with software-enabled warranties and updates.

9. Apply Agile and Lean Startup Principles for Rapid Innovation

Implement continuous iteration loops to reduce risk and validate assumptions early:

Build MVP → Test with Customers → Collect Metrics → Analyze → Pivot or Persevere

This approach accelerates product-market fit and deepens customer engagement.


10. Commit to Ongoing Learning on Automotive Technologies and Standards

Stay ahead by mastering:

  • Automotive communication protocols like CAN and OBD-II.
  • Safety and cybersecurity standards (e.g., ISO 26262).
  • Regulatory updates on emissions, EV guidelines, and diagnostics.
  • Advances in AI, blockchain, and IoT relevant to automotive tech.

Resources like SAE International, IEEE Vehicular Technology Society, and open-source projects such as OpenXC are invaluable.
